Photosmart C8180 doesn't will not print to photo tray.

I'm trying to print to the Photo Tray, but it is telling me that I'm out of paper and to add it to the Main Tray.  This is after I've already selected all the appropriate settings before printing.  This has happened once before and I fixed it by installing some drivers.  However, I had to re-install the software for whatever reason and I've installed the drivers and still --nothing.

 

The crazy thing is that when I re-installed the software as mentioned, it ran a test print using one of my own photos and it printed fine-- from the Photo Tray!

 

Any tips?
